Rio De Janeiro (GIG) to Maceio (MCZ)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Galeao - Antonio Carlos Jobim International Airport (GIG) in Rio De Janeiro, Brazil to Zumbi dos Palmares Airport (MCZ) in Maceio, Brazil is 1,679 kilometers (1,043 miles / 906 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 3h, flying north northeast at a heading of 29°.

This is a medium-haul route that may be operated by either narrow-body or wide-body aircraft depending on demand. Passengers can expect a meal service on most carriers.

This is a domestic route within Brazil. Both airports operate in the same country, which may simplify travel requirements and documentation.

Time zone information: When it's 10:51 in Rio De Janeiro, it's 10:51 in Maceio.

The return flight from Maceio (MCZ) to Rio De Janeiro (GIG) follows a heading of 207° (south southwest).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
